Overview

Guanine is a **purine nucleobase** (chemical formula C₅H₅N₅O) and serves as one of the four principal bases in DNA and RNA, designated by the symbol **G**. In DNA, guanine pairs with cytosine via three hydrogen bonds, contributing to the stability and information encoding of the double helix. It is a planar, aromatic, double-ring structure forming part of the nucleic acid backbone, and also participates in cellular energy metabolism as a component of guanosine triphosphate (GTP). Guanine is susceptible to chemical modifications such as oxidation and alkylation, which can lead to mutagenesis and play roles in disease and therapeutic contexts [1][2][3][4][5][6][7][8].

Mechanism of action

Alkylation or modification of guanine bases disrupts base pairing, triggering cell cycle arrest or apoptosis; Intercalation between guanine bases disrupts DNA replication and transcription; Platinum agents form adducts with N7 of guanine, causing DNA crosslinking and double-strand breaks
